Transaction 52fbf9aec33b63f9db4d2f3c126e1a102aeeab6a186700681ac545e84e2a1723

1 Input
2 Outputs
  • 52fbf9aec33b63f9db4d2f3c126e1a102aeeab6a186700681ac545e84e2a1723:0
  • value  993875495
    address  3KjGJriom972bxzceDBScFm1smjytgFN5F
  • 52fbf9aec33b63f9db4d2f3c126e1a102aeeab6a186700681ac545e84e2a1723:1
  • value  181290
    address  1P8LkQWtbbhBRYPiqFDK6fQbC6sDwWVUzp